Summary History: The current being overweight epidemic is thought to be partly pushed by about-usage of sugar-sweetened meal plans and delicate beverages. Reduction-of-Command more than ingesting and habit to drugs of abuse share overlapping brain mechanisms which includes improvements in motivational travel, such that stimuli that in many cases are no longer 'liked' remain intensely 'needed' [7], . The neurokinin one (NK1) receptor procedure continues to be implicated in both equally acquired appetitive behaviors and dependancy to Liquor and opioids; having said that, its role in all-natural reward in search of continues to be not known. Methodology/principal conclusions: We sought to find out whether the NK1-receptor method plays a job inside the reinforcing Homes of sucrose using a novel selective and clinically Secure NK1-receptor antagonist, ezlopitant (CJ-eleven,974), in 3 animal versions of sucrose usage and looking for. In addition, we in contrast the impact of ezlopitant on ethanol use and trying to get in rodents. The NK1-receptor antagonist, ezlopitant diminished appetitive responding for sucrose far more potently than for ethanol applying 4-b]pyrazine an operant self-administration protocol without the need of impacting common locomotor exercise.

Considering that the medical introduction of aprepitant, there have also been advancements in the design of additional strong and for a longer period performing tachykinin NK1 receptor antagonists (Reddy et al., 2006; Rojas Rel-5-(4-Chloro-2-fluorophenyl)-2 et al., 2014). Netupitant is usually a novel orally Lively compound that penetrates in the brain and has a lengthy length of action and an insurmountable blocking exercise at NK1 receptors (Rizzi et al., 2012).
